Installing the TR-4 EIDE Tape Drive
To install this drive, you must have the following:
vAn IDE controller that supports the ATA Packet Interface (ATAPI). The ATAPI interface provides for communications between the store controller and the tape drive.
vThe documentation that comes with your store controller.
Step 1. Preparing for Installation
1.Turn off the store controller and unplug the power cables from the power outlet for the store controller and all attached peripherals.
2.Open the store controller. For speci®c information on opening your store controller refer to the documentation that comes with your store controller. Become familiar with the store controller's internal components, and determine what kind of con®guration you need to install.
3.Locate an available IDE connector on the secondary IDE cable in your store controller. The tape drive only works on the secondary IDE cable. If your store controller does not have a secondary IDE cable, you must add one. Because most IBM PC computers do not include a secondary IDE cable, you must purchase an IDE cable separately.
